Keelan Harvick leads as CARS Tour Pro Late Model field wrecks on restart at Cordele

Halfway through this CARS Tour Pro Late Model race, Keelan Harvick leads, but most of the field just got wadded up in a crash. A massive wreck on a restart has caused damage to about a dozen cars.
This is Keelan Harvick’s CARS Tour debut. He’s racing the No. 62 Rackley WAR car. It is actually a bit of a throwback paint scheme to his dad, Kevin Harvick, when he drove the No. 2 truck in the Truck Series. EZGO was a sponsor for Kevin and is now for Keelan as well.
Well, the 12-year-old son of a NASCAR champion was leading this Pro Late Model race at Cordele Motor Speedway at the time of this wreck. Let me remind you, he’s only been racing full-body stock cars for a few months now.
Massive wreck. Race still has plenty of laps to go.
So, Keelan Harvick lost the lead once this race restarted again. A bit of a botched restart caused him to get passed by others. Colin Allman has taken the lead with Hudson Bulger, Tristan McKee, Jett Noland, and Harvick trailing.
McKee is a 14-year-old development driver for Spire Motorsports. He is a name to watch for in a couple of years in ARCA and the Truck Series.
Keelan Harvick started this race on the pole. He is going to have to work very hard to get himself back to the lead. If he is patient and takes care of his tires, he might be able to do it. Already quite a debut for the CARS Tour at Cordele and for Keelan in this series.

Keelan Harvick is taking the next step
Racing full body stock cars is a huge step up for Keelan Harvick. Coming from his Legend Cars, the Limited Late Model and Pro Late Model cars are a new challenge. One that he has taken in stride. He has been very impressive already with just a few races under his belt.
Later this year, Kevin Harvick will race against his son. That’s right, father against son. That will be a great learning opportunity for the young Harvick as he learns how to race against his dad. Which better be with the utmost respect.
Keelan Harvick is a talented driver. He also has help from his dad, Rodeny Childers, and many others that have been through around the NASCAR block once or twice or 20 times.
All eyes are on the young driver in the No. 62. His dad is the big name, but Keelan is starting to make one for himself.
